Destination: INDIA

Proverbs 16:9 says “In his heart a man plans his course, but the Lord
determines his steps,” and we are finding this to be so true with our work
with the follow up video!

Eric originally would have been returning from his trip to India this week, but due to some scheduling conflicts, as we write this letter, he is getting ready to leave FOR India. He will leave on October 2nd and will be there until the 18th.

We are thankful that God is completely in control of all things! Susan, the producer, arrived in India safely. Upon arrival and speaking with the Indian Campus Crusade staff, she realized that they needed more time to look through and edit the script. After many emails between Eric, Susan and the staff, and several late night calls to India (they are 10 and a half hours ahead of us!), the script was finally a finished product that the Indians felt would be effective with the new believers.

The next change was the set itself. Originally, Susan’s idea was to build a set for the video shoot. But, the production company felt it would be best to shoot in an actual village to make it more authentic. So it took a little more time to make those arrangements as well.

Now the time has finally arrived for Eric to go. He is THRILLED at this amazing opportunity to have a part in impacting millions of Indians with this follow up video. The video will be comprised of five lessons: God’s character; the uniqueness of Jesus Christ and how His sacrifice paid our sin debt; prayer: talking to God and listening when He talks to us; being a follower of Christ (once we accept the gift of salvation we are changed and have a role in the Kingdom to fulfill); and sharing your faith with others (the responsibility that all believers have and how to do it effectively). Prayerfully, these lessons will help give new Indian believers the foundation they need to begin and continue to grow in the relationship with Christ.
